Internal Growth Rate
The maximum rate at which a company can expand its operations using only internally generated revenues, without resorting to external financing.
Plowback Ratio
The proportion of earnings retained by a company after dividends are paid, usually to fund growth or pay down debt.
Debt-Equity Ratio
A measure used to evaluate a company's financial leverage, calculated by dividing its total liabilities by its shareholders' equity.
Financial Plan
A comprehensive evaluation of an individual's or organization's current and future financial state by using known variables to predict future cash flows, asset values, and withdrawal plans.
